Output ca2312f02ba0221ec7d697608efdd3427980f0f21810aba5e2e9723a563bed00:0

value
505251187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f2a484c43f009c8afea3e4b9701444b43c653a2 OP_EQUAL
address
3GCc1suBuE3GsS4ovV67aRBDdZZdnoKKg4
transaction
ca2312f02ba0221ec7d697608efdd3427980f0f21810aba5e2e9723a563bed00
confirmations
305813
spent
true